Coliseum Expansion Set for Ribbon Cutting, Public Tour

FORT WAYNE, Ind. (WOWO): An expansion project for Memorial Coliseum in Fort Wayne is nearly done.

The public's invited to an open house and ribbon cutting ceremony on Friday, December 18th from 4-7pm for the Coliseum's new Conference Center, which has been under construction for more than a year and will be finished well ahead of its first public event, which is a bridal show the first weekend of January. 

The Conference Center adds more than 50,000 square feet to the building, making the Coliseum the second-largest public assembly facility in Indiana, second only to Lucas Oil Stadium.
